Output 4192a2c26f1a4218e4a516f6dce06a7968884c6168355944fc6190611f19c88c:24

value
5310957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334c55740839ade3ebbe2a15e7b5bd8c84e1ccc0 OP_EQUAL
address
MCaQ8yjqNDEb7pad4w2KfQZR2PgPP2LzGy
transaction
4192a2c26f1a4218e4a516f6dce06a7968884c6168355944fc6190611f19c88c
spent
true